問題タブ [rxvt]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
bash - cygwin rxvt で表示される色を変更するにはどうすればよいですか?
印刷する"\[\e[34m\]sometext"
と文字が青く表示されますが、どこかに青の濃淡を指定できますか?
terminal - rxvtファミリーの端末の色を明るくするにはどうすればよいですか?
特定のコマンドの色を明るくする方法は知っていますが、すべてのコマンドで標準のANSI色を明るくしたいと思います。
shell - MSYS シェルをめぐる騒ぎ - 交換可能ですか?
MSYS 用のサービス可能なシェルが必要です。これは私の現在のジレンマです:
デフォルトの rxvt.exe にはスクロール バーとコピー アンド ペーストがありますが、制御文字や矢印キーをシェルで実行中のプログラム (インタープリター/デバッガーなど) に送信しません。Haskell インタプリタ ghci を使用する場合、これは本当に厄介です。
もう一方のシェル sh.exe は制御文字 (または少なくともその一部) を処理しますが、スクロール バーやコピー アンド ペーストはありません。
rxvtには、出力バッファリングに関する(比較的)より多くの問題もあります
私のオプションは何ですか?代替シェルは msys 対応である必要がありますか? 私が望むのは、Haskell (ghc)、C++ (gcc)、および基本的なツール チェーン (make とその他) で動作する健全な環境だけです。クレイジーな悪ふざけがなければ、シェルをコンパイルするつもりです。
cygwin - cygwin xterm がキーボードに反応しない
Cygwin xterm がキーボードに反応しません。
rxvt は実行できますが、他の X アプリケーションを起動すると同じ問題が発生します。
rxvt コマンド プロンプトから、次のメッセージが表示されます。
私の XWin.0.log の内容は次のとおりです。
/tmp/.X0-lock を削除しても解決しませんでした。
windows - Cygwin/Windows に最適な端末環境は?
rxvt
今日、次の起動行を使用してCygwin を実行します。
これにより、デフォルトで提供される標準の「DOS ボックス」よりもはるかに優れたサイズ変更可能なネイティブ Windows ウィンドウが得られcygwin.bat
ます。
ただし、現在の構成にはいくつかの問題があります。
- 非 ASCII 文字を端末ウィンドウに入力することができません (つまり、æ、ø、å および Æ、Ø、Å など、私はこれらをやや頻繁に使用します)。 「bølle」(ノルウェー語で「いじめっ子」)のような文字列を貼り付けると、「blle」しか表示されません。
- UTF-8 文字をレンダリングできません。フォントでサポートされている場合でも、? としてのみ表示されます (つまり、ISO-8859-1 で同じ文字をレンダリングすると、問題なく表示されます)。
ロケールとキーボード レイアウトをノルウェー語 (ISO-8859-1 文字セット?) に設定して英語の Windows Vista を実行していますが、Windows 2000 と XP でもまったく同じ問題が発生しました。
これを修正する方法を知っている人はいますか (つまり、rxvt を構成するためのより良い方法)?
上記の問題を除けば、私は に非常に満足してrxvt
いるので、それらを解決する方法が見つかれば、引き続き使用したいと考えています。ただし、問題が (簡単に) 解決できない場合、Cygwin の他の適切なターミナル ソリューションはありますか?
アップデート
Andy と Mattias (.inputrc
ファイルの編集) によって提供された解決策は、入力の問題を解決しましたが、出力のレンダリングは依然として問題です。ISO-8859-1 でレンダリングすると出力に問題はありませんが、UTF-8 を使用すると ? 非ASCII文字用。この動作はrxvt
、urxvt
(Cygwin XFree X Server の下で)mintty
と PuttyCyg の間で一貫しています。
出力エンコーディングを設定できる同様の構成ファイルはありますか (つまり、Linux システムで出力ロケールを設定するのと同等です)。
fonts - rxvt がフォントの間隔を数マイル離すのを止める方法は?
MinGW/MSYS の最新リリースをインストールしました。退屈な Windows コマンド プロンプトで rxvt ターミナルを使用するのが好きです。しかし、この新しいビルドは文字のスペースが多すぎます: 私が試したほとんどのフォントはめちゃくちゃです - Courier New (ttf)、Consolas (ttf)、または PC6X13 (fon) でさえ。
少なくとも読みやすいので、プレーンな OLD Courier で立ち往生しています。そこに解決策はありますか?簡単な解決策が好まれます。ソース コードにパッチを当てて rxvt を再コンパイルするのは好きではありません。
shell - コマンドを使用したssh ....さらにシェル
マシンに SSH で接続し、コマンドを実行 (cd またはスクリプトの実行または su) してから、シェルを提供するコマンドが必要です。コマンドを ssh に渡すと、常に終了するようです。
私が探しているもののいくつかの例: 'ssh me@machine1 "./executeMyScript && cd /developmentDirectory"' すると、シェルが返されます。
これを行う理由は、起動時に実行するすべてのタブのコマンドを定義できる mrxvt (タブ付き x 用語) を使用しているためです。同じマシンにいくつかの ssh 接続をしたいのですが、ssh 後に別のことをさせたいと思っています。
-ロブ
ありがとう!
git - rxvt/cygwinではgitの配色はありません
デフォルトのcygwinターミナルに飽きた後、試してみることにしましrxvt
た。1つを除いて、すべてが正常に見えます。私のgitリポジトリの配色が機能しなくなります。
ところで、エディタのような他の配色は、のvim
下でうまく機能しrxvt
ます。また、このスクリプトを実行して、256色が有効になっていることを確認しました。
私~/.gitconfig
は次のように見えます:
rxvt - rxvtにshift+tabを認識させる方法はありますか?
rxvtターミナルセッション中にshift+tabを認識されたキーシーケンスにしようとしているだけです。だから私はそれを次のような有用性にマッピングすることができます:
しかし、私の調査によれば、答えはノーだと確信しています。確認したいだけです。
これはrxvtの厳しい制限ですか?(この制限の技術的な理由はありますか?それともサポートされていない機能だけですか?)
bash - 履歴でヒアドキュメントとその入力を記録できるようにするにはどうすればよいですか?
コマンドラインを使用すると、CPまたは上矢印を使用して履歴を呼び出すことができます。ただし、ヒアドキュメントへの入力を呼び戻そうとすると、これは機能しません。
私はrxvtを使用しています。
PSこの機能は、shell
内で使用する場合に正しく機能しますemacs